The passion for the mountains and skiing has often led me to visit different appealing places in the Alps like Switzerland. In the collective imagination, Switzerland is a place known for its deep valleys, steep slopes, rocks and glaciers. Nevertheless, even in an austere impervious territory, the vines surprises us with heroic forms of viticulture. The canton of Valais, a district with around 5000 hectares of vineyards, was a surprise for me. During a trip decided at the last minute to understand where to spend the end of 2017, together with my wife we reached our friends in Crans-Montana. Along the road that leads from Sion to this beautiful alpine village we witnessed a unique view. Vineyards with narrow planting layout on steep slopes until 1000 meters above sea level, all facing south where the sun warms them even during the frosty days of winter.
